Inspection Details:
- 51-11-4:Basic - Carbon dioxide tanks not adequately secured. Tanks by back soda bib rack not secured at time of inspection. **Warning**
- 50-09-4:Basic - Current Hotel and Restaurant license not displayed. Establishment is licensed but license is available for viewing. Spoke with operator about importance of having license displayed at time of inspection. **Warning**
- 40-06-5:Basic - Employee personal items stored in or above a food preparation area, food, clean equipment and utensils, or single-service items. Observed employee phone stored over pizza on main line. Operator moved phone to lower shelf during inspection. **Corrected On-Site** **Warning**
- 36-73-4:Basic - Floor soiled/has accumulation of debris. Floor soiled in kitchen around equipment legs at time of inspection. **Warning**
- 08B-38-4:Basic - Food stored on floor. - Food stored on floor in walk in cooler at time of inspection. **Warning**
- 53A-01-7:Intermediate - Manager or person in charge lacking proof of food manager certification. No proof of certified food manager training at time of inspection. **Warning**
- 31B-02-4:Intermediate - No paper towels or mechanical hand drying device provided at handwash sink. No paperwork towels at hand wash sink next to triple sink at time of inspection n **Warning**
- 53B-01-5:Intermediate - No proof of required state approved employee training provided for any employees. To order approved program food safety material, call DBPR contracted provider: Florida Restaurant and Lodging Association (SafeStaff) 866-372-7233. All three employees at time of inspection unable to provide proof of any food handler training. **Warning**
- 11-26-1:Intermediate - No proof provided that food employees are informed of their responsibility to report to the person in charge information about their health and activities related to foodborne illnesses. **Warning**
Food safety inspection conducted on 2/24/2025 revealed 9 total violations (0 high priority, 4 intermediate, 5 basic).
